首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

自定义matplotlib轴,显示一定范围内的所有值

自定义matplotlib轴是指通过对matplotlib库中的轴进行自定义设置,来显示一定范围内的所有值。下面是完善且全面的答案:

在matplotlib中,可以使用plt.axis()函数来自定义轴的范围。该函数接受一个包含四个值的列表,分别表示x轴的最小值、最大值,以及y轴的最小值、最大值。通过设置这些值,可以控制轴的显示范围。

例如,如果要显示x轴范围为0到10,y轴范围为-5到5的所有值,可以使用以下代码:

代码语言:txt
复制
import matplotlib.pyplot as plt

# 生成数据
x = range(100)
y = [i/10 - 5 for i in x]

# 绘制图形
plt.plot(x, y)

# 自定义轴范围
plt.axis([0, 10, -5, 5])

# 显示图形
plt.show()

在上述代码中,首先生成了一组数据,然后使用plt.plot()函数绘制了图形。接着使用plt.axis()函数自定义了x轴和y轴的范围为0到10和-5到5。最后使用plt.show()函数显示了图形。

自定义matplotlib轴的优势在于可以根据数据的特点和需求,灵活地调整轴的范围,使得图形更加直观和易于理解。

自定义matplotlib轴的应用场景包括但不限于以下几个方面:

  1. 数据可视化:当需要将数据在图形中进行展示时,通过自定义轴的范围,可以更好地展示数据的分布和趋势。
  2. 统计分析:在进行统计分析时,通过自定义轴的范围,可以突出关键数据的变化情况,帮助分析人员更好地理解数据。
  3. 学术研究:在学术研究中,通过自定义轴的范围,可以更加准确地展示实验结果,方便其他研究人员进行参考和复现。

腾讯云提供了一系列与云计算相关的产品,其中包括云服务器、云数据库、云存储等。这些产品可以帮助用户快速搭建和管理云计算环境,提供稳定可靠的计算和存储资源。

以下是腾讯云相关产品和产品介绍链接地址:

  1. 云服务器(CVM):提供弹性计算能力,支持多种操作系统和应用场景。产品介绍链接
  2. 云数据库MySQL版:提供高性能、可扩展的MySQL数据库服务。产品介绍链接
  3. 云对象存储(COS):提供安全可靠的对象存储服务,适用于图片、音视频、文档等各种类型的数据存储。产品介绍链接
  4. 云函数(SCF):无服务器计算服务,支持按需运行代码,无需管理服务器。产品介绍链接

通过使用腾讯云的这些产品,用户可以快速搭建自己的云计算环境,并且根据实际需求进行灵活的轴范围自定义。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券